(LVN) Sr. Licensed Vocational Nurse - Internal Med - 139677
Under the direct supervision of a registered nurse in La Jolla Internal Medicine, the LVN performs a wide variety of patient care activities in support of clinic activity. This includes prioritizing and assisting in patient triage processing, preparation and assistance with patient examinations, administering medications, drawing blood, collecting and preparing laboratory tests, and patient education. Position requires initiative, able to prioritize critical demands and the ability to work in a team environment.
Minimum Qualifications:
- Licensed Vocational Nurse (LVN) issued by the state of California.
- BART or BLS at time of hire with commitment to get BART within six (6) months of hire date.
- Minimum two (2) years of LVN experience.
- Thorough knowledge of universal precautions and proper use of body mechanics.
- Proven ability to take initiative, prioritize critical demands and work in a team environment.
Pay Transparency Act
Annual Full Pay Range: $74,980 - $93,229 (will be prorated if the appointment percentage is less than 100%)
Hourly Equivalent: $35.91 - $44.65
Factors in determining the appropriate compensation for a role include experience, skills, knowledge, abilities, education, licensure and certifications, and other business and organizational needs. The Hiring Pay Scale referenced in the job posting is the budgeted salary or hourly range that the University reasonably expects to pay for this position. The Annual Full Pay Range may be broader than what the University anticipates to pay for this position, based on internal equity, budget, and collective bargaining agreements (when applicable).
